Study for a career in computer science

As computers have permeated every part of our day-to-day lives, so has the need for skilled computer science professionals erupted through business and industry.

Computer science degree candidates learn fundamental skills to developing computer hardware and software applications. With broad exposure to industrial design, human engineering, and critical thinking, computer science students discover how to use technology to solve problems.

No longer confined to high level research institutions in Silicon Valley, computer science professionals can compete for lucrative jobs in just about any industry, anywhere in the world. The Bureau of Labor Statistics has already observed the way that many companies have integrated computer science professionals into the administrative and professional teams at a variety of companies.

According to a recent BLS survey, most computer science professionals earned about $62,000, while enjoying some of the most comfortable work environments in American industry. Although the dot-com era of foosball tables in the lobby has come and gone, computer science specialists can still participate in exciting startup ventures, potentially earning significant rewards in the form of stock options and company ownerships. More traditional companies lure computer science graduates with profit sharing plans, strong benefits packages, and flexibility in choosing job hours and locations.

Central Connecticut State University
Central Connecticut State University offers the following Data Mining online degree prgrams:
  • Master of Science in Data Mining
  • Certificate in Data Mining

The Master of Science in Data Mining is the first such University program in the world. Students will apply such methodologies as decision trees, market basket analysis, neural networks, classification rules, and cluster detection and will gain strong exposure to the Clementine data mining software suite from SPSS. Self-study or instructor-led: All courses designed and taught by full-time Ph.D. faculty specialists. Accreditation information: Licensed by the Board of Governors of Higher Education, State of Connecticut.

University of Texas
The Computer Science/Electrical Engineering (CS/EE) Online degree program is a collaboration between The University of Texas at Arlington and The University of Texas at Dallas for the purpose of providing telecommunications professionals an opportunity to get a Master's degree. The CS/EE Online Program is comprised of three degree options. Choices include master's degrees in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science or Computer Science and Engineering. All three degrees are conferred with the Graduate Telecommunications Engineering Certificate. The CS/EE Online program is offered predominantly using the Internet, but may include supplemental materials such as video/audio tapes and CD-ROM. There is no residency requirement. Acc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ools.
